Bio: Faye Olayo is a writer, performer, and story-teller. She is a member of the writers collective Ubbog Cordillera Young Writers and the Baguio Writers Group. Faye’s poetry is a form of autobiography, a reflection of passions, struggles, and triumphs. She writes about what she knows, what she doesn’t know and what she’s learned. She writes about the things that almost killed her. She writes about surviving. She writes about heal- ing. She doesn’t write for a living but she does write to stay alive. Faye has performed at vari- ous events in stages across the Philippines and in South East Asia. She recently headlined JackIt, a monthly performance event in Kuala Lumpur. And because of her work’s subject-topic, she has also performed at the Child Protection Network’s Ako Para Sa Bata International Conference and the National Family Planning Youth Conference.
